The film delves into themes of grief, loss, and the complexities of human relationships, exploring the emotional turmoil of the protagonist as she tries to make sense of her strange bond with her deceased friend. As she confronts her own past traumas and the legacy of her family's military history, she is forced to confront the complexities of her own identity and the impact of her experiences in the military.
With a mix of drama, mystery, and emotional depth, My Dead Friend Zoe (2024) takes viewers on a journey of self-discovery and healing as the protagonist navigates the blurred lines between the living and the dead, ultimately leading to a powerful climax that challenges perceptions of reality and the nature of human connection.
